Daniel Waldron
Acumen

Daniel Waldron is Head of Insights at Acumen. He collaborates with Acumen’s regional and functional teams to identify the lessons from its activities, and use them to make Acumen and its partners more effective in solving problems of poverty.

Prior to joining Acumen in 2020, Dan spent five years working with the Consultative Group to Assist the Poor, a research center at the World Bank focused on financial inclusion. He managed research and technical assistance for 18 asset finance companies in Africa and Asia, and summarized the findings in a technical guide to managing credit risk.

Dan holds a master’s degree from The New School, and a bachelor’s degree from New York University. He is also a former Peace Corps Volunteer, having served in Tanzania from 2010 to 2012.
